v16.10.0

Compare Source

Feature
  • Added filterResults option to filter out upgrades based on a user provided function.

filterResults runs after new versions are fetched, in contrast to filter and filterVersion, which run before. This allows you to filter out upgrades with filterResults based on how the version has changed (e.g. a major version change).

Only available in .ncurc.js or when importing npm-check-updates as a module.

/** Filter out non-major version updates.
  @​param {string} packageName               The name of the dependency.
  @​param {string} currentVersion            Current version declaration (may be range).
  @​param {SemVer[]} currentVersionSemver    Current version declaration in semantic versioning format (may be range).
  @​param {string} upgradedVersion           Upgraded version.
  @​param {SemVer} upgradedVersionSemver     Upgraded version in semantic versioning format.
  @​returns {boolean}                        Return true if the upgrade should be kept, otherwise it will be ignored.
*/
filterResults: (packageName, {currentVersion, currentVersionSemver, upgradedVersion, upgradedVersionSemver}) => {
  const currentMajorVersion = currentVersionSemver?.[0]?.major
  const upgradedMajorVersion = upgradedVersionSemver?.major
  if (currentMajorVersion && upgradedMajorVersion) {
    return currentMajorVersion < upgradedMajorVersion
  }
  return true
}

v16.8.0

Compare Source

Feature

  • Added --format lines

    $ ncu --format lines
    @​ava/typescript@^4.0.0
    ava@^5.2.0
    eslint@^8.36.0
    lerna@^6.5.1
    typescript@^5.0.2

This is particularly useful for upgrading global modules:

npm install -g $(ncu -g --format lines)

v16.4.0

Compare Source

Feature

Added --cacheClear option for—you guessed it—clearing the cache 🫥.

This brings the suite of cache-related options to:

  • --cache : Cache versions to the cache file.
  • --cacheClear : Clear the default cache, or the cache file specified by --cacheFile.
  • --cacheExpiration <min> : Cache expiration in minutes (default: 10).
  • --cacheFile <path> : Filepath for the cache file (default: "~/.ncu-cache.json").

v16.3.0

Compare Source

Feature

  • Added workspace support! 🚢

Upgrade all workspaces:

ncu --workspaces
ncu -ws

Upgrade a single workspace:

ncu --workspace a
ncu -w a

Upgrade more than one workspace:

ncu --workspace a --workspace b
ncu -w a -w b

Upgrade all workspaces AND the root project:

ncu --workspaces --root

Upgrade a single workspace AND the root project:

ncu --workspace a --root

Notes

  • If workspaces or --workspace is run in --interactive mode, ncu will prompt to npm install once in the root project rather than separately in each workspace (#​1182).
  • Running --deep will not trigger workspace support.

v16.0.0

Compare Source

Breaking
  • Automatic detection of package data on stdin has been removed. This feature was deprecated in v14.0.0. Add --stdin for old behavior.
  • Wild card filters now apply to scoped packages. Previously, ncu -f '*vite*' would not include @vitejs/plugin-react. Now, filters will match any part of the package name, including the scope. Use a more specific glob or regex expression for old behavior.

v15.0.0

Compare Source

Breaking
  • node >= 14.14 is now required (#​1145)
    • Needed to upgrade update-notifier with has a moderate severity vulnerability
  • yarn autodetect has been improved (#​1148)
    • This is a patch, though technically it is breaking. In the obscure case where --packageManager is not given, there is no package-lock.json in the current folder, and there is a yarn.lock in an ancestor directory, npm-check-updates will now use yarn.
    • More practically, if you needed to specify --packageManager yarn explicitly before, you may not have to now

image ##### Static Registry

A new option --packageManager staticRegistry allows upgrades to be recommended from a static JSON file. This can be used to power custom versioning infrastructure that is completely independent from the npm registry.

Thanks to agrouse who did a fine job on the PR.

Example:

$ ncu --packageManager staticRegistry --registry ./my-registry.json

my-registry.json:

{
  "prettier": "2.7.0",
  "typescript": "4.7.0"
}

The latest versions of prettier and typescript are set in the registry file. When ncu is run, it will recommend upgrades from the static registry file without touching the npm registry:

$ ncu --packageManager staticRegistry --registry ./my-registry.json
Checking /Users/raine/projects/ncu-issues/14.1.0/package.json
[====================] 2/2 100%

 prettier    ^2.0.1  →  ^2.7.0
 typescript  ^3.4.0  →  ^4.7.0

Run ncu -u to upgrade package.json

v14.0.0

Compare Source

Breaking

Prerelease versions are now "upgraded" to versions with a different preid.

For example, if you have a dependency at 1.3.3-next.1 and the version fetched by ncu is 1.2.3-dev.2, ncu will suggest an "upgrade" to 1.2.3-dev.2. This is because prerelease versions with different preids are incomparable. Since they are incomparable, ncu now assumes the fetched version is desired.

Since this change affects only prereleases, there is no impact on default ncu usage that fetches the latest version. With --pre 1 or --target newest or --target greatest, this change could affect which version is suggested if versions with different preids are published. The change was made to support the new --target @&#8203;[tag] feature.

If you have a use case where this change is not what is desired, please report an issue. The intention is for zero disruption to current usage.

Features
  • You can now upgrade to a specific tag, e.g. --target @&#8203;next. Thanks to IMalyugin.

v13.0.0

Compare Source

Breaking
  • node >= 14 is now required
  • Several options which have long been deprecated have been removed:
    • --greatest - Instead use --target greatest
    • --newest - Instead use --target newest
    • --ownerChanged - Instead use --format ownerChanged
    • --semverLevel - Renamed to --target
